Output e87d4298d51667f5a7089c0efe3182a07753e743acf1c139eacb1a5e57df3aee:6

value
42146216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64d46aec1a524c7e72319ffaea69747a2148694f OP_EQUALVERIFY OP_CHECKSIG
address
1AC93DpyrkZ99qHk4EHWv2aM4CHGbNbKh8
transaction
e87d4298d51667f5a7089c0efe3182a07753e743acf1c139eacb1a5e57df3aee
spent
true